As of release 14.2, the password reset flow uses short-lived, single-use tokens issued by the Cinderpath token service instead of emailed links that never expired. If a user reports a "token expired" error, first confirm their clock skew is under five minutes, then check whether the reset was initiated from the legacy portal, which is now read-only. Escalations go to the Identity rotation. Before escalating, compare the user's environment against the current service configuration shown below.

deployment values, yahag-tawef:
ZORWYN_HOST=zorwyn.tolvaqlabs.internal
ZORWYN_PORT=9300

# SproutTimer watering scheduler — environment file
# Maintained for release cuts; do not hand-edit in production.
# SPROUT_SCHEDULE_CRON controls the evaluation interval (default every 10 min).
# SPROUT_MOISTURE_THRESHOLD is a percentage; values under 20 trigger immediate watering.
# SPROUT_ZONE_COUNT must match the valve controller's configured zones or the
# scheduler refuses to start. All of the above are safe to commit.
# The valve controller API requires an access credential, which is set on the
# following line.

vault entry, yahif-yajep: COURIER_KEY29=b802bdf8034096b65a51c6ba5abe2

## Key Ceremony Checklist — Item 7: LintScroll Signing Key

Contractor: LintScroll (our docs linter) refuses unsigned rule packs. During the ceremony you will regenerate the pack-signing key.

Do: verify two witnesses present, wipe the old key from the Mossgate HSM, generate the new key, sign the baseline rule pack, record serials in the ceremony log. Do not skip witness sign-off.

To unseal the HSM slot, enter the recovery passphrase printed below.

vault phrase of fahog-yajof = istael-zorwyn

## Limits & Quotas — Ferngate API (post N+1 fix)

Quick background: the old resolver fired one database query per list item, so a single dashboard load could hammer the Ferngate backend with hundreds of lookups. We now batch those through a dataloader layer, which is why customers stopped seeing timeout errors on big org pages. Support folks: if someone hits the new batch limits, that's expected behavior, not a bug. The limits currently enforced are shown below.

tuning table, yajog-yahof:
BUDGETS = {
    "lamvan": 303,
    "wenox": 460,
    "fenvan": 525,
}